Job Description:

Parsons is now hiring for a Bridge Engineer II to join our Troy team! In this role you will get to design and inspect major bridge projects in Michigan and through the support of our nationwide network of bridge offices.

What You'll Be Doing:
  • Design and analysis of conventional and complex bridges, culverts, earth retaining structures and other underground structures
  • Prepare new design and rehabilitation plans and calculations using federal, state, and local specifications, guidelines and standards
  • Conduct bridge load ratings for various bridge types
  • Inspect major bridges in Michigan and surrounding states, providing condition assessments and scoping reports
  • Develop cost estimates
  • Create project special provisions and specifications for unique bridge project elements
  • Assist with bridge proposal and marketing efforts
  • CADD design and coordination including some drafting

What Required Skills & Qualifications You'll Bring:
  • 5+ years of structural design knowledge
  • Familiarity with structural analysis software including LEAP, STADD, or similar
  • Experience preparing DOT and/or local agency bridge design packages
  • Understanding of MicroStation and/or AutoCAD/Civil 3D
  • Excellent technical writing skills, including proficiency with the Microsoft Office Suite and Adobe Acrobat and/or Bluebeam
  • Self-motivation to work independently as well as through coordination within bridge design and/or inspection teams
  • Ability to communicate technical concepts across disciplines
  • Professional Engineering license
  •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ering with structural engineering emphasis

What Desired Skills & Qualifications You'll Bring:
  • Knowledge of Michigan Department of Transportation Standards and Typical Details
  • Masters of Science in Civil Engineering with emphasis in structural engineering
